DEC. 28, 2005

It was close, but in the end, Marion County voters determined that development of a multimillion-dollar casino-based business was not what they wanted. The vote was 2,577 for and 2,377 against, making it fail 52% to 48%.

The annual New Year’s Eve ball drop and fireworks will begin at 11:45 p.m. Saturday.

Cardie Oil Inc. of Tampa was sold Sept. 15 to Shawmar Oil and Gas Company of Marion. A feature story by Rowena Plett tells the history of the Tampa business that was operated for 66 years by the family of G.G. and Ruth Mueller.

The family of Jackie Hett met Dec. 20 at a Wichita motel for their annual Christmas celebration. This was their 19th year to celebrate.

The grand opening of St. Luke Hospital Auxiliary Thrift Shoppe, 404 E. Main St., Marion, will be 1:30 p.m. Dec. 30.

Beautiful weather and warm temperatures in the 50s Monday let children of all ages try out new toys they received for Christmas. Tyler Wildin and Bailey Shiplet are pictured trying out new electric scooters they received from Santa.
